REBOUND, Inc., represented by Johnny Gibson, has applied to rezone 820 S Clay St from UN/C1 to R-8A to build Grace Hope Senior Apartments. The project would put a 22-unit senior living community on about 0.6 acres with a new building of roughly 9,778 square feet on land owned by Grace Hope Presbyterian Church Inc. It’s pitched as multi-family housing in a Traditional Neighborhood form district and has already prompted about 115 meeting-notification postcards as it works its way through the zoning process.
Elridge Co LLC has submitted a permit to build a new single-family home at 7724 Woodbridge Hill Lane. Christopher Eldridge of Eldridge Company is the licensed professional on the project, which is planned as a two-story, 5,920 sq ft, five-bedroom residence with an estimated cost of $2,196,800. The record shows no separate auxiliary garage and that automatic sprinklers are not required or provided, so it reads like a large private home rather than a multi-unit or commercial build.
Excel Services Inc. is handling a commercial HVAC install at 4500 Commerce Crossings Dr for owner Commerce Investments LLC. The job is a substantial HVAC refresh—installing and starting up four gas rooftop units, two split systems, and roof-mounted exhaust fans (condensers at ground level, ladder access provided)—with a project value estimated at $1,268,000.
